Overview:
Facilitate and administer the processing and payment of company invoices.
Responsibilities:
Leadership and Direction
- Perform work under moderate supervision. Receive direction on moderately complex assignments, tasks, and execution. Work is frequently reviewed by more senior staff to ensure application of sound techniques and principles. Review work produced by junior staff for quality assurance.
At the Operational and Company Level
- Coordinate with various regional and corporate services departments on accounts payable matters.
Do the Work
- Collect and verify all incoming invoices.
- Code incoming invoices and bills and log them on internal systems.
- Review receipts and records to reconcile discrepancies.
- Confirm appropriate approvals before processing invoices.
- Analyze account trends and routine transactions.
- Pay vendors, suppliers, and employees, and maintain records of each account.
- Track invoices and payments due, prioritizing in accordance with invoice terms and accounting schedules.
- Keep current on accounting department policies and payment schedules.
